    Agriculture Officer

    Location: Southern Katsina/Northern Kaduna, Nigeria
    Division: Enterprise and Community Development
    Reports To: Project Director, Rayuwa Nigeria
    Supervisory Role: Supervise the Agriculture team

    Summary

    • We are seeking qualified candidates for the position of Agriculture Officer to be based full-time in the Southern Katsina/Northern Kaduna Office, Nigeria.
    • This position will work with the Rayuwa Project team to implement an integrated community development project with a focus on enhancing resilient agriculture and accountable education in the region.
    • The Rayuwa Project is housed within the Enterprise and Community Development division of PYXERA Global.
    • PYXERA Global has worked in over 90 countries since 1990, with the Enterprise and Community Development division seeking to strengthen the local systems that drive prosperity and opportunity that forge community resilience.
    • The Rayuwa Project involve collaboration with diverse partners and a drive to be continuously adaptive to the local context.
    • The Agriculture Officer will provide technical expertise and will work with the project team to implement the project’s resilient agriculture activities.
    • The ideal candidate will have extensive experience in smallholder agriculture, agribusiness, and training and/or extension service delivery.
    • Additionally, the candidate will be familiar with a diverse set of agricultural value chains and an understanding of monitoring and evaluation (M&E) practices.
    • Candidates with experience working on international development initiatives and who speak English and Hausa fluently are preferred.

    Key Position Responsibilities
    The Agriculture Officer will report directly to the Rayuwa Project Director and will have the following responsibilities:

    • Support overall technical expertise and management of all agricultural-related activities.
    • Provide relevant technical guidance and collaborate with project team and stakeholders to design and deliver the participatory agriculture and rural enterprise development project. Key responsibilities include: engaging and building strong relationships with community members, support M&E team in analyzing data collected to identify agricultural-related gaps, designing priority action plans and training modules on improved agricultural techniques, mechanizations, inputs, etc. in partnership with the community.
    • Develop a clear and adaptive training work plan based on the seasonal calendar, farmer availability, project deadlines and targets, etc.
    • Incorporate adult learning skills objectives and techniques to prepare and deliver training modules to follow adult learning quality standards.
    • Establish and develop various locally applicable agricultural interventions and oversee capacity building of local farmers and the local agriculture sector.
    • Facilitate and provide guidance to farmers on appropriate cropping patterns, farming techniques, etc.
    • Manage a project market study to establish project impact tracking indicators and design key technical focus areas for project interventions.
    • Through the agriculture team, provide guidance to farmers on various available Government schemes/programs and how to access them, and identify opportunities to leverage and integrate existing schemes into project activities to maximize the impact of the project and drive project sustainability.
    • Document field achievements, innovations, failures, and lessons learned to integrate into project activities and inform project strategy.
    • Provide input on monitoring & evaluation tools to ensure accurate data collection, verification and analysis of training activities, and to avoid duplication of efforts.
    • Support the development of project reports on agriculture activities, as needed.
    • Conduct frequent site visits to observe trainings, monitor adoption of practices, and collect data from farmers.
    • Staff capacity building: Oversee capacity building of Rayuwa agriculture team.
    • Exhibits and is committed to the Rayuwa Values of: honesty, transparency, integrity, humility, freedom to innovate, equality, keep a “light” attitude, quality, teamwork, focus on the goals, accountability to all partners, and monitoring to learn and improve.
    • Other duties, as assigned.

    Qualifications

    • Master's Degree in Agronomy, Agribusiness, or related field.
    • At least 6 years' experience in agriculture or agribusiness, with a minimum of 3 years in training/capacity building of smallholder farmers. Hands-on field experience required, field experience in the Southern Katsina/Northern Kaduna region preferred.
    • Demonstrated experience designing and implementing adult learning training modules on agriculture practices or relevant content - including curriculum, lesson plans, objectives, and learning assessments.
    • Knowledge of water resource management, resilient farming practices, and/or adaptation and farmer risk mitigation techniques preferred.
    • Familiarity with agricultural and livestock production, market-linkages, and agricultural constraints.
    • Excellent facilitation skills, familiarity with training-of-trainer (ToT) approaches and methodologies, and competencies to use tailor-made and diversified facilitation/training methods and tools.
    • Demonstrated expertise in agronomic practices, financial literacy, farmer loans and credit, on-farm technologies and capacity building programs for farmers and non-farm agriculture-based livelihood trainings. Experience in ‘farming as a business’ and engagement with youth is an advantage.
    • Candidates fluent in English and Hausa preferred.
    • Professional experience in Southern Katsina/Northern Kaduna, Nigeria, preferred.
    • Nigerian national required.
